HVAC Leak Water Removal Cost In Aubrey, TX

The cost of HVAC leak water removal can v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Aubrey, TX. Our team will provide a free estimate for your specific situation, taking into account any necessary repairs or replacements.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and drying $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of leak, and equipment needed
Repair or replacement of damaged parts $1,000 – $5,000 Severity of damage, type of part, and labor required
Dehumidification and drying equipment rental $100 – $500 Duration of rental, type of equipment, and local conditions
Final inspection and cleanup $100 – $500 Size of affected area, type of debris, and local conditions
Emergency service call $100 – $500 Time of day, distance traveled, and urgency of situation

Common Questions About HVAC Leak Water Removal

Q: What causes HVAC leaks?

A: HVAC leaks can be caused by a variety of factors, including clogged condensate lines, faulty coils, and refrigerant leaks. Our team can help you identify and fix the issue.
